Functional Description ? help Back to Top
Source Description
UniProtBinds to the G-box-like motif (5'-ACGTGGC-3') of the chalcone synthase (CHS) gene promoter. G-box and G-box-like motifs are defined in promoters of certain plant genes which are regulated by such diverse stimuli as light-induction or hormone control.
